The unit does everything described well. The screen quality is decent and responsive. One mistake I made was just connecting the aux cable and not selecting the output in the settings. The sound came out of the left side only so I thought there was a problem. It worked as intended once I'd selected aux on the device settings. The Bluetooth connection is far better than the aux Imo. You also have 1 less cable. Make sure to set up android auto connection first and then select the output to Bluetooth on the device. You then connect your phone to the cars Bluetooth and it will auto connect everything in future. Brilliant product for £60. Well worth it.

Pro-tip: Set up a driving mode so your phone automatically turns on Bluetooth and Wifi whenever it connects to either one (this screen requires both for Android Auto) and location for GMaps. I wanted to change the logo from the default sports car to the car company logo so the device looks more "stock." I contacted customer service and they walked me through the process via email. In case anyone is interested in how to do this there is a SD card reader under the sticker that has the button functions on the left side of the device. I formatted the SD card as an ExFAT device on my PC and created a 1024 x 600 72 dpi JPEG image which was saved as boot_logo.jpg on the SD card. I booted the device up without the card in the slot. After the device was powered up, I put the card in and saw a message that notified me that the boot logo had been updated. I shut the device down and removed the card. Upon the next boot, the new logo appeared and that was it. Thanks to Nancy at LAMTTO for the guidance to get this done.
